VietNamNet Bridge – Construction of a 12km road linking the Noi Bai International Airport to Nhat Tan Bridge in Dong Anh district, Hanoi, began on August 1.

The road with high technical standards is expected to improve the traffic from central Hanoi to the airport and contribute to economic growth in Hanoi and northern Vietnam.

The project will include five installation and construction contract packages. The first package will cover more than 1.5km and last 30 months. The project is scheduled for completion in 2014.

Under an agreement signed between the Vietnamese government and the Japan International Cooperation Agency (JICA), the latter pledged to provide over JPY 6.5 trillion (US$83 million) for the project. JICA said it will provide next loans based one the progress of the project.

Addressing the groundbreaking ceremony, Deputy Prime Minister Hoang Trung Hai thanked the Japanese government for continuing to give Vietnam ODA, while Japan is still confronted with many difficulties caused by the March earthquake and tsunami.

Once the road is completed, the distance between the airport and central Hanoi will be shortened to only 15km, including 12km of road and 3km of Nhat Tan Bridge.
